Fast Food Revamped

Tonight we did a new take on burgers and fries. We made turkey burgers and sweet potato fries. The meal was excellent.

This meal serves 4. You need:

-1 pound of ground turkey
-1 clove of garlic
-some diced onion
-some diced mushrooms
-sprinkle of Parmesan cheese
- 1/4 tablespoon of egg whites
- salt and pepper.

Mix all the ingredients together and make 4 individual patties. Even though it's summer, we cooked them on a frying pan because we don't have a grill. They cook about 7 minutes on each side.

For the french fries:
-4 small sweet potatoes - scrubbed but not peeled. We cut shoestring style and seasoned with salt and pepper and olive oil. We cooked at 400 for 20 minutes. If you want crispier fries, we suggest 25-30 minutes in the oven.

For toppings we used:
-1/2 avocado
-pepper jack cheese
-bacon which Tori burnt to a crisp

Any toppings would be great including the traditional onions, tomatoes, lettuce and pickles! You could also use an actual bun :) we went bunless.
